I was surprised that the film started with the OOO portion instead of the Fourze one. Usually, the DC cuts have the newer Rider series before the epilogue of the older one.
Gentarou doing Stronger's pose after transforming into Fourze was a new scene.
The scene with Gentarou talking with Yuuki and Tomoko after realizing that Nadeshiko wasn't human was also an extended one.
The interaction between Gamou and Foundation X had an extended scene.

The movie additions consisted of extending most of the fight scenes, extension of Gotou and Kougami along with Satanoka and Hina, and a bunch of other scenes were slightly extended. Kannagi gets a bunch of new dialogue and even the silent black guy gets a speaking line. Also this image is a DC addition, look at the error code. Someone thinks nonhumans are devils.

It works as a bit of nonlinear storytelling, and it honestly does it better than some of Den-O's details. Eiji has been going on adventures since the end of OOO. This movie happens. Sometime between the end of MEGAMAX and Poseidon's birth 40 years in the future, one of Eiji's adventures results in Ankh being brought back. That's a story we may or may not get to see. When the meteor rips apart the fabric of time Ankh goes back to help his old friend and give him hope for the future.
It's a complete saga with massive future story potential. It's a much better story than what happened in Fourze. If something like that happened with Ankh, it would have been a copout.
